Vice President Kashim Shettima has dismissed claims that governors are being pressured to defect to the ruling All Progressives Congress (APC), insisting that those joining the party are doing so voluntarily.
Shettima clarified while representing President Bola Ahmed Tinubu at an interfaith Iftar held at the Aso Rock Presidential Villa, Abuja.
The gathering brought together political leaders, religious figures and government officials to observe both Ramadan and Lent.
Addressing concerns over the recent wave of defections to the APC, Shettima rejected suggestions that state governors were being forced to join the ruling party.
“Nobody is coercing the governors of Rivers, Delta, Kano or any other state to join the APC. It is at their own volition because they have seen the light,” Shettima said.
He added that the ruling party currently enjoys a stronger political position compared to the period leading up to the 2023 Nigerian general election.
“Politically speaking, we are in a more comfortable position now than in 2023,” the Vice President noted.
Shettima also criticised opposition parties, accusing them of spreading misinformation and engaging in political hypocrisy as the country gradually approaches another electoral cycle.
In particular, he aimed at the African Democratic Congress (ADC) for its earlier advocacy of the electronic transmission of election results.
According to him, the party undermined its own credibility after launching an online membership registration portal that allegedly became flooded with questionable entries.
“The same people who were adamant that we must have electronic transmission of votes opened their portal for membership registration, and it was flooded with fake names and fictitious identities,” he said.
The Vice President urged members and supporters of the APC to remain loyal and actively promote the administration as political activities begin to intensify ahead of the next election season.
“Excellencies, distinguished ladies and gentlemen, the political season is around the corner. We are all political actors. We have to sell our government. We have to stand behind our administration,” Shettima added.
